Hi there!  Today is blog hop day for Papertrey Ink.  If you'd like to see what everyone has created, you can check out the links on Nichole's blog.  This month's challenge was to create an interactive card.  This one took me all morning to create, but I think it was worth the effort! 

Here's the front of the card:



As you can see, I alluded to the fun to come inside!  Here's another look with a peek at the inside.


Ok, now for the fun...open it up and this is what you see...


Fun right???  To make the pop up part of this card, I made slits in the white cardstock that allowed me to fold it forward...similar to PTI's new die that came out last month.  I wish you could see this card in motion, because the flowers move a little when you open it.  They are mounted on acetate strips of paper which are then mounted on the back of the pink birthday sign.  This allows them to move a little more freely.  Here's a closer look...

Ok, on to some crafty stuff.  This week's Make it Monday challenge on Nichole Heady's blog is to glitter up some buttons and add them to your project.  I have to admit, when I started this card I really had no idea where it was going or where it would end up, but I'm pretty pleased with the final product.  I'm loving the happy colors...time for spring! 



In her MIM video, Ashley Cannon Newell used some silvery Prisma glitter on her buttons (really pretty), but I decided to use some black Martha Stewart glitter I had on hand.  I thought the dark buttons made more of an impact on this card.
